Comment(by pooze):

 I have the same problem. Updated to the testing repo just a few hours ago.
 Struggled getting my icons back. Now they are back, but still cannot open
 Settings. Tried running it from the commandline, which gives me the
 following output:

 root at om-gta02:~# exposure.py -f run
 Traceback (most recent call last):
   File "/usr/bin/exposure.py", line 304, in <module>
     import etk
   File "/usr/lib/python2.5/site-packages/etk/__init__.py", line 1, in
 <module>
     from core import *
   File "/usr/lib/python2.5/site-packages/etk/core.py", line 1, in <module>
     import c_etk
 ImportError: /usr/lib/python2.5/site-packages/etk/c_etk.so: undefined
 symbol: evas_list_append

 Hope this is helpfull. I have no permission to re-open though.
